What Factors Should You Consider When Choosing a Collar for Your Chow Chow?

When selecting the best collar for your Chow Chow, several key factors should be taken into account.

  • Size: Ensuring the collar is the right size is crucial for your Chow Chow’s comfort and safety. A collar that is too tight can cause choking or discomfort, while one that is too loose may slip off or become a hazard during walks.
  • Material: The material of the collar affects both durability and comfort. Leather collars are strong and stylish, while nylon collars are lightweight and often more affordable, making them suitable for everyday use.
  • Adjustability: An adjustable collar allows you to customize the fit as your Chow Chow grows or if their weight fluctuates. This feature is particularly important for puppies or dogs undergoing weight changes, ensuring a secure fit without the need for frequent replacements.
  • Style: A collar’s design and color can reflect your Chow Chow’s personality. While the aesthetic might seem less important, a well-chosen collar can enhance your dog’s appearance and ensure they stand out during outings.
  • Safety Features: Look for collars with safety features such as quick-release buckles or reflective materials. These elements enhance the safety of your pet, particularly during walks in low-light conditions or in case of accidental snagging.
  • Type of Collar: Different types of collars serve various purposes. A standard flat collar is perfect for everyday use, while a martingale collar offers extra control without choking, making it ideal for training sessions.
  • Leash Compatibility: Consider how the collar will work with your leash. Some collars are designed to accommodate specific leash attachments, which can enhance your control over your Chow Chow during walks.

What Types of Collars are Most Suitable for Chow Chows?

The best collars for Chow Chows should prioritize comfort, strength, and control due to their unique physical characteristics and temperament.

  • Martingale Collar: This type of collar is designed to provide gentle control without choking, making it ideal for Chow Chows who may pull during walks. The collar tightens slightly when the dog pulls, preventing escape while remaining comfortable and secure.
  • Flat Collar: A flat collar is a classic choice for identification and everyday use. It is simple to put on and take off, and when properly fitted, it can comfortably hold tags and a leash without causing discomfort to the Chow Chow.
  • Head Halter: This collar style is particularly useful for training and managing strong pullers like Chow Chows. By gently guiding the dog’s head, it allows for better control while walking, making it easier to redirect their attention and reduce pulling behavior.
  • Chest Harness: A harness that fits around the chest distributes pressure evenly, reducing strain on the neck, which is particularly beneficial for a breed prone to respiratory issues. It provides more control and is a safer option for leash training, especially for strong and stubborn Chow Chows.
  • Quick-Release Collar: This collar is designed for safety, featuring a mechanism that allows for quick removal in emergencies. It is ideal for Chow Chows who may get into situations where they could be at risk, ensuring they can be quickly freed without struggle.

In What Situations is a Harness a Better Choice for Chow Chows?

A harness can be a better choice for Chow Chows in several specific situations:

  • Leash Training: When starting leash training for a Chow Chow, a harness can provide better control and reduce the risk of injury to the dog’s neck. It distributes the pressure more evenly across the dog’s body, making it a safer option, especially for strong-willed breeds like Chow Chows who may pull on their leash.
  • Health Concerns: For Chow Chows with respiratory issues or neck problems, a harness is preferable as it avoids putting strain on their neck. This helps prevent exacerbation of any existing health issues, ensuring the dog remains comfortable during walks and outdoor activities.
  • Outdoor Adventures: When engaging in activities such as hiking or running, a harness offers more security and stability. It allows for better control over the dog during these vigorous activities, reducing the likelihood of slipping out of the collar or getting injured during sudden movements.
  • Behavioral Management: For Chow Chows that tend to be reactive or anxious, a harness can help manage their behavior more effectively. It allows owners to steer their dog gently without causing panic or discomfort, making it easier to navigate challenging situations like crowded places or encounters with other dogs.
  • Escaping Risk: Chow Chows, being strong and sometimes stubborn, may try to escape traditional collars. A well-fitted harness reduces the chance of escape during walks or in unfamiliar environments, providing peace of mind to owners.

What Materials Are Recommended for Chow Chow Collars?

The best materials for Chow Chow collars focus on comfort, durability, and safety.

  • nylon: Nylon is a popular choice for dog collars due to its lightweight and durable nature. It’s resistant to wear and tear, making it ideal for the active lifestyle of a Chow Chow, and is available in a variety of colors and patterns, allowing for personalization.
  • leather: Leather collars offer a classic and stylish option that is both strong and long-lasting. They provide comfort and a snug fit for Chow Chows, but require regular maintenance to keep them looking their best and to prevent cracking or drying out.
  • neoprene: Neoprene is a synthetic rubber material that is soft, flexible, and water-resistant, making it suitable for outdoor activities. It provides a comfortable fit and is often padded, which is beneficial for the thick fur of Chow Chows, preventing irritation on their skin.
  • cotton: Cotton collars are soft and breathable, ideal for dogs with sensitive skin. They are often machine washable, making them easy to clean, but may not be as durable as nylon or leather for heavy use.
  • biothane: Biothane is a synthetic material that mimics the properties of leather while being waterproof and easy to clean. It’s an excellent option for Chow Chows that enjoy water activities, as it won’t retain moisture and is resistant to odors and bacteria.

What Features Can Enhance a Collar for Chow Chows?

The best collar for Chow Chows can be enhanced with several key features to ensure comfort and functionality.

  • Adjustable Fit: An adjustable collar allows for a customized fit, accommodating the unique neck size of a Chow Chow as they grow or if their weight fluctuates. This feature ensures that the collar is not too tight, which could restrict movement, or too loose, which could lead to slipping off.
  • Durable Material: Chow Chows have thick fur and strong necks, so a collar made from durable materials like nylon or leather can withstand wear and tear. High-quality materials also resist fraying and can endure harsh weather, making them suitable for outdoor activities.
  • Padded Interior: A padded collar provides extra comfort for a Chow Chow’s thick neck, preventing irritation and chafing during walks. The cushioning helps distribute pressure evenly, which is especially important for this breed known for its robustness.
  • Reflective Elements: Collars with reflective stitching or panels enhance visibility during nighttime walks, increasing safety for both the dog and the owner. This feature is crucial for Chow Chows, who can be quite independent and may stray from their owner’s side in low-light conditions.
  • Leash Attachment Options: A collar that includes multiple leash attachment points, such as a standard D-ring and a secondary clip, offers versatility for various walking styles and harness combinations. This is beneficial for Chow Chows, who may require different handling methods based on their temperament or energy level.
  • Personalization: Customizable collars with tags or embroidery allow owners to add their pet’s name or contact information, enhancing safety should the dog get lost. Personalized collars can also reflect the unique personality of a Chow Chow, making them a stylish accessory.
  • Breakaway Feature: A breakaway collar is designed to release under pressure, reducing the risk of choking or injury if the dog gets caught on something. This is particularly important for Chow Chows, who may be prone to exploring tight spaces due to their curious nature.
